М.: Вильямс, 2004. — 752 с.
В этом полном справочнике по C# — новому языку программирования, разработанному специально для среды .NET, — описаны все основные аспекты языка: типы данных, операторы, управляющие инструкции, классы, интерфейсы, делегаты, индексаторы, события, указатели и директивы препроцессора. Подробно описаны возможности основных библиотек классов C#.В этом полном справочнике по C# - новому языку программирования, разработанному специально для среды .NET, - описаны все основные аспекты языка: типы данных, операторы, управляющие инструкции, классы, интерфейсы, делегаты, индексаторы, события, указатели и директивы препроцессора. Подробно описаны возможности основных библиотек классов C#.
Введение
Язык C#Создание языка C#
Обзор элементов языка C#
Типы данных, литералы и переменные
Операторы
Инструкции управления
Введение в классы, объекты и методы
Массивы и строки
Подробнее о методах и классах
Перегрузка операторов
Индексаторы и свойства
Наследование
Интерфейсы, структуры и перечисления
Обработка исключительных ситуаций
Использование средств ввода-вывода
Делегаты и события
Пространства имен, препроцессор и компоновочные файлы
Динамическая идентификация типов, отражение и атрибуты
Опасный код, указатели и другие темы
Библиотека C#Пространство имен System
Строки и форматирование
Многопоточное программирование
Работа с коллекциями
Сетевые возможности и использование Internet
Применение языка C#Создание компонентов
Создание Windows-приложений
Синтаксический анализ методом рекурсивного спуска
ПриложенияКраткий обзор языка комментариев XML
C# и робототехника
Предметный указатель